Azerbaijan earns $2B from oil exports
Energy
- 16 March, 2021
- 12:00
In January-February 2021, Azerbaijan exported 5.694 million tonnes of crude oil and petroleum products obtained from the bituminous rocks worth $ 2.044 billion, respectively up 0.3% and down 25% from the previous year, Report informs, referring to the State Customs Committee (SCC).
Share of the abovementioned products in Azerbaijan’s total exports made up 83.9%.
